Description

CoreWeave is seeking an experienced PLM Architect to co-lead the technical design, architecture, and implementation of a new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) system across the organization.

The Hardware Quality team within Supply Chain is building the systems, governance, and cross-functional processes needed to support product lifecycle management at scale. This role partners closely with Supply Chain Transformation,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, and IT to help design and implement a new PLM foundation for the organization.

Responsibilities:

  • Co-lead end-to-end architecture and design for a new enterprise PLM system, including data model, workflow, integration, and security architecture.
  • Partner with business stakeholders across Transformation,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, and Supply Chain to gather requirements and translate them into a scalable, future-proof PLM architecture.
  • Partner with IT to define requirements and oversee integrations between the PLM system and adjacent enterprise platforms, including ERP, MES, CAD/CAM, and QMS.
  • Establish data governance standards, including item and part numbering schemes, BOM structures, change management workflows, and revision control practices.
  • Lead technical design reviews and ensure architectural decisions align with long-term scalability, performance, and maintainability goals.
  • Guide data migration strategy and validation from legacy systems into the new platform.
  • Identify opportunities for process standardization and automation across the product lifecycle.
  • Define and enforce PLM system standards, governance policies, and documentation practices.
  • Act as the primary technical escalation point during implementation, troubleshooting complex architectural or integration issues.
  • Mentor junior architects, analysts, and administrators on PLM best practices.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Computer Science, Information Systems, or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.
  • 10+ years of experience working with PLM systems, including at least 5+ years in an architect or lead technical design role.
  • Proven experience leading at least one full-cycle, new PLM system implementation, not just administration or support of an existing system.
  • Hands-on expertise with one or more major PLM platforms.
  • Strong understanding of PLM data models, including BOM management, item and part structures, change management (ECR/ECO), document control, and revision practices.
  • Solid grasp of data migration methodologies and legacy system decommissioning.
  • Excellent stakeholder management skills, with the ability to translate between technical architecture and business needs.
  • Strong documentation skills, including architecture diagrams, technical specifications, and system design documents.
